![]() Check in on yourself a few times a day and see if any of those words accurately describe how you’re feeling. Start with the “Beginner’s List” - perhaps put a copy in your phone for easy reference.Here are just a few ideas see what works best for you. As well, there are probably some new words you would use - if you only knew them! Use JMA’s list to remind yourself of words you can use - while learning some new ones, too. You probably know many more words for feelings than you actually use in daily life you just don’t think of them. Your significant other gets angry at you – you feel confused– you fumble, or ask questions.Your significant other gets angry at you – you feel attacked – you defend.Your significant other gets angry at you – you feel enjoyment– you gloat. ![]()
